Match the polymers given in column I with the type of linkage present in column II and mark the appropriate choice.
| Column I | Column II | ||
(A) |
Terylene |
(i) |
Glycosidic linkage |
(B) |
Nylon |
(ii) |
Ester linkage |
(C) |
Cellulose |
(iii) |
Phosphodiester linkage |
(D) |
RNA |
(iv) |
Amide linkage |
- (A) → (ii), (B) → (iv), (C) → (iii), (D) → (i)
- (A) → (ii), (B) → (iv), (C) → (i), (D) → (iii)
- (A) → (iii), (B) → (ii), (C) → (iv), (D) → (i)
- (A) → (iv), (B) → (ii), (C) → (iii), (D) → (i)
Answer
(B) (A) → (ii), (B) → (iv), (C) → (i), (D) → (iii)
